750ml bottle #108/300 poured into a pint glass
A: Slightly hazy amber color with a thin head that disappears quickly
S: Lots of malt vanilla and bourbon notes but not a ton else
T: Matches the nose - lots of malt, pure vanilla and some vanilla on the finish
M: Medium-bodied, very smooth and very creamy
O: I like this and the barrel aging treated it very well. That being said this could go from very good to great if the underlying beer (which I have yet to try) had more complexity before the barrel contribution

750 ml bottle, bottle #130 of 300, best before March 2015. Served in a nonic pint glass, the beer pours a mostly clear reddish/amber color with about an inch off-white head. Head retention and lacing are both good. The brew smells like bourbon, vanilla, toffee, caramel malt and a bit of dark fruit. Taste is pretty much just like the aroma, but there's also some nuts and earthy/woodiness noticeable. The bourbon is there, but it's not overpowering at all. Mouthfeel/body is medium, it's slick and a bit creamy with moderate carbonation. I thought this was a good brew, now I'll have to try the regular Elektron soon. This is kinda pricey at $14.99 a bottle (but then it was aged in bourbon barrels for 6 months), but I think it's certainly worth picking up!
